Drmota, M and Tichy, RF (1997)

Sequences, Discrepancies and Applications

Lecture Notes in Mathematics 1651.

ISSN/ISBN: Not available at this time. DOI: Not available at this time.



Abstract: The main purpose of this book is to give an overview of the developments during the last 20 years in the theory of uniformly distributed sequences. The authors focus on various aspects such as special sequences, metric theory, geometric concepts of discrepancy, irregularities of distribution, continuous uniform distribution and uniform distribution in discrete spaces. Specific applications are presented in detail: numerical integration, spherical designs, random number generation and mathematical finance. Furthermore over 1000 references are collected and discussed. While written in the style of a research monograph, the book is readable with basic knowledge in analysis, number theory and measure theory.
